This Practical Guide on Alternative Development and the Environment brings together best practices and common success factors that could be used to inform the design, planning and implementation of alternative development and broader sustainable livelihood interventions. It offers guidance, not perfect solutions or success models. The best practices and success factors included are neither panaceas nor one-size-fits-all solutions that will be guaranteed to work everywhere. Instead, the usefulness of these guidelines and best practices will need to be assessed locally and, where relevant, they will need to be tailored to the local context and conditions. The guide covers four main thematic areas: Environmentally sustainable practices and approaches: A broad range of approaches and instruments that attempt to balance productivity, profitability and environmental protection and sustainability. Forest conservation: A range of approaches to preserve forests, water sources, biodiversity and ecosystems in general. Carbon credit schemes: Instruments to preserve forests and initiate other activities that help maintain, capture, secure and store carbon dioxide from the atmosphere. Payments for Environmental Services: An instrument to provide some additional income (or in kind compensation) to farmers and communities in exchange for services that benefit various aspects of the environment

This directory lists competent national authorities empowered to issue certificates and authorization for the import and export of narcotic drugs and psychotropic substances; and competent national authorities empowered to regulate or enforce national controls over precursors and essential chemicals; International bodies that might assist national competent authorities in case no authority is listed for a given country or region, or in case contact cannot be established with the listed authorities. The directory also includes contact details of national competent authorities or international bodies and is issued annually. Introductory texts in Arabic, Chinese, English, French, Russian and Spanish.

The World Drug Report provides a comprehensive overview of recent developments in the world's illicit drug markets. Chapter one of the World Drug Report 2016 provides a global overview of the latest statistics, trends and developments with respect to opiates, cocaine, cannabis and synthetic drugs, ranging from production to trafficking as well as consumption and the health consequences of drug use. Chapter two utilizes the Sustainable Development Goals framework to examine the interplay between the drugs phenomenon and the broader development context.

For the first time since its conception, this year the World Drug Report presents the latest global, regional and subregional estimates of and trends in drug demand and supply in a user-friendly, interactive online format. The new online segment is designed to both enhance and simplify access to the wealth of information provided in the report by presenting the data in the form of succinct key messages supported by interactive graphs, infographics, and maps. Booklet 1 takes the form of an executive summary that sets out points of special interest and policy implications based on analysis of the key findings of the online segment and the thematic booklet 2 and the conclusions that can be drawn from them. The World Drug Report 2023 is aimed not only at fostering greater international cooperation to counter the impact of the world drug problem on health, governance, and security, but also at assisting Member States in anticipating and addressing threats posed by drug markets and mitigating their consequences
